Customer support that doesn't run your life.
An email inbox you can run yourself, or drive from your AI. See who's writing and what they paid before anyone replies.
Four things.
Your inbox sorts itself. VIPs first, then longest wait.
Default order is longest-waiting first. Mark someone VIP, they jump to the top. Nobody gets buried by a newer email.
It's email. Not chat.
Chat trains your customer to wait. Green bubble, typing indicator, every signal promises a reply any second. Email doesn't make that promise. They write a sentence, hit send, get on with their day.
Drive it from your AI.
Plug your AI into the inbox. It sends on its own, drafts for your approval, or just looks things up. You own every reply.
Every purchase, every charge. Before you read a word.
Sarah bought Fusionaly in January. She's spent $174. Subscription active. You see all of that before you reply.
Read your guides. Or write you.
Two affordances, one widget. Whatever the visitor sends lands in your inbox as email; the conversation continues from there. Nobody waits for a green dot.
I read every email myself. Usually reply within a day.
sarah@acme.com
Founder voice. First-person greeting. Contact-first because the relationship is the offer.
How can we help?
Brand voice. A label, not a name. Guides up front because the company is the offer.
One script tag.
Paste once on your authenticated app pages. Required: tenant, user-email, user-name. The rest are optional — sensible defaults applied if you omit them.
<script src="https://app.suppyhq.com/w.js"
data-suppyhq-tenant="acme"
data-suppyhq-user-email="{{ current_user.email }}"
data-suppyhq-user-name="{{ current_user.name }}"
data-suppyhq-position="right"
data-suppyhq-avatar-mode="face"
data-suppyhq-label="How can I help"
data-suppyhq-headline="I read every email myself. Usually reply within a day."
data-suppyhq-success-title="Got it."
data-suppyhq-success-message="I'll reply by email as soon as I can."
defer></script> Stop answering the same question twice.
When a new email looks like one you've handled before, SuppyHQ surfaces your past replies. Click one to drop it in, edit if you want, send. It matches on meaning, not keywords, and only ever pulls answers you wrote yourself.
Jordan Lee
New email · 2 minutes ago
How do I export my data?
Reusing your reply from Exporting your data
Settings → Export. It builds a zip and emails you the download link, usually within a minute.
Polar and Stripe. Plug in once. Stay out of your dashboard.
Read-only Polar and Stripe keys, encrypted
Your API key is read-only. We can't charge, refund, or create subscriptions. Stored encrypted, sent over TLS.
Charges and refunds, instantly
When Polar or Stripe processes a payment, it's in your inbox in under a second. No polling, no manual refresh.
Pull your customers, or start fresh.
Day one: import every existing customer. Or skip it and only see new activity.
Where it lives, who can touch it: the stack →
I've shipped Fusionaly, LogNorth, and Pomotto. I handled my own support from Gmail, cross-referencing my dashboard to figure out who was writing me. I built SuppyHQ so I could see the customer and reply in one place.
I use SuppyHQ for my own support across Fusionaly, LogNorth, and Pomotto. You'd be among the first founders outside of me.
One person runs this. I have technical access to your data. I don't read it unless you email me for help.
Questions? karloscodes@suppyhq.com.
The facts.
Free until you've talked to more than 10 people. $19/month after.
Your price is locked the day you sign up. It never goes up on you.
-
Your own you@suppyhq.com address
Yours forever. No one else can take it.
-
Customer context next to every email
Stripe and Polar purchases, subscriptions, refunds.
-
Past replies on similar emails
Reuse what you already wrote. Stop answering the same question twice.
-
Auto-reply, follow-ups, broadcast letters
All built in. No add-ons, no upgrade tier.
-
Agents API and CLI
Read threads, post drafts, work the inbox from your AI tools.
-
5,000 emails a month
More if you ask.
-
Export your data anytime
Full archive in a ZIP. Conversations, customers, attachments.
-
Cancel anytime
No questions. No retention pitch.
No card to start. Pay only once you've talked to more than 10 people.
FAQ
Questions.
Who is this for?
You sell software, courses, or digital products. You have 1 to 5,000 customers. You handle support yourself. You're tired of checking your inbox and cross-referencing your payment dashboard.
How do customers contact me?
Two ways. You get a unique address (you@suppyhq.com); put it on your site and customers email it directly. Or use the widget: one line of HTML that drops a button on your site. When a customer clicks, they type a message and the thread continues over email. Either way, every conversation lands in your SuppyHQ inbox with the customer's full history next to it.
Can I use my existing email?
Yes. Forward your support@ address to your SuppyHQ address and every incoming message shows up in SuppyHQ with full customer context. You can keep replying from your old inbox if you want. BCC your SuppyHQ address on the reply and it files the outgoing message in the thread too.
Can I send from support@mycompany.com?
Not today. Customers email yourname@suppyhq.com and replies go from there. If you'd use it, tell me. That's how features get built.
I sell multiple products. Does SuppyHQ handle that?
Yes. Connect your one Stripe or Polar account and SuppyHQ picks up every product, every customer, every purchase. A customer who buys two of your products shows up as one person with two purchases.
Does SuppyHQ send marketing emails?
No cold email. No lead lists. No strangers. Every message, including follow-ups and letters, goes to someone who already bought from you.
Is there an email limit?
5,000 outbound emails a month. That's plenty for a real business talking to real customers. If you're close to the cap for legitimate reasons, email me and I'll bump it. If you want to blast cold lists, we're not the tool.
How much does it cost?
$19/mo flat. Free until you've talked to more than 10 people. No card, no time limit. Past 10, you move to $19/mo, locked at your signup price for life.
What happens when I've talked to more than 10 people?
You get 7 days to add a card. After that, outbound replies pause until you pay. Inbound mail keeps flowing. Nothing is lost. $19/mo, locked at your signup price.
Does connecting Stripe or Polar count against my free 10?
No. Importing customers is free. The count is people who've actually written in, so you only start paying once your 11th person starts a conversation. Connect an account with thousands of customers and you're still on the free tier until they reach out.
Where is my data stored?
On a Hetzner server in Germany. Conversations, customer data, and file attachments, all in one place, on one server I own. TLS in transit. One person has access: me. We don't sell your data.
Can I export my data?
Yes, anytime. Request an export from settings and you get a zip with every conversation, every customer record, every attachment. No waiting, no tier requirements. It's your data.
What if you disappear?
Solo dev, single VPS, daily encrypted backups. Every conversation, customer, and message exports as a ZIP from settings. Your data doesn't depend on me staying online.
What if I delete my account?
Delete from settings. Your conversations, customer data, payment history, and files are wiped within 15 days. Your SuppyHQ address is retired forever. No one can take it or impersonate you.